Offers residents of Nassau, Suffolk and Queens a unique Certified Financial Planner Program with a curriculum focused on developing 21st century financial planning skills. This intensive program prepares accountants, attorneys, bankers, insurance agents, brokers, security representatives and other professionals to better help their clients achieve their financial goals. In association with the Certified Financial Planner Board of Standards, Inc., Hofstra University Continuing Education also offers this program to prepare individuals with the educational requirements to qualify for the Certified Financial Planner (CFP) exam. To qualify for the exam, students must successfully complete seven courses. Sample Course offerings include: Fundamentals of Financial Planning; Risk and Insurance Planning; Investment Planning; Income Tax Planning; Employee Benefits and Retirement Planning; Estate Planning and Certified Financial Planning Capstone Case Applications. Provides free, one-on-one business advising. This free technical assistance is available to anyone who wants to start a business or who already owns a business. Services range from answering startup and business structure questions to assisting with business plans, cash flow projections, marketing plans, and loan information. The mission of the SBDC is to provide professional business advisement, education, network resources and to advocate for small business and entrepreneurs. The SBDC at Farmingdale State College plays a key role in economic development by providing free, high-quality, technical and management assistance to start-up and existing small businesses. Talented, certified SBDC business advisors are ready to counsel and train you to make your business succeed. Through direct, one-on-one counseling, the SBDC provides a range of management and technical assistance services and information, including: Small Business; Start-Up; Business Plan Development; Organizational Structures; Financial Planning; Cost Analysis; Loan Information and Marketing Assistance.
